
Charmme Kaur turns heads with slim and sexy look on 37th birthday
Actress-turned-producer Charmme Kaur is back in the spotlight, not for a film release but for her striking transformation. Celebrating her 37th birthday, the Mass and Lakshmi star took to social media to reveal her new look—sporting a casual white tee, black shorts, boots, and shades—with a caption that read, 'Gifted myself good health this birthday.'
Charmme, who made her Telugu debut over two decades ago with Nee Thodu Kavali, has carved a unique path in the industry. Her youthful charm and energetic performances quickly earned her a place among Telugu cinema's most adored heroines. However, in recent years, she has shifted focus from acting to film production, collaborating closely with director Puri Jagannadh under their joint banner, Puri Connects.
Her latest pictures, showcasing significant weight loss and a toned physique, have sparked admiration online. Fans and colleagues have praised her dedication to fitness and her no-frills, confident appearance—echoing the spirited vibe of her early career days.
On the professional front, Charmme is now co-producing a high-profile project featuring Vijay Sethupathi and Tabu, directed by Puri Jagannadh. The film is set to be another ambitious outing under the Puri Connects banner, following projects like Liger and the upcoming Double iSmart.
While Charmme may have stepped away from acting, her evolving role in cinema—both as a trendsetting actress and a dynamic producer—continues to inspire. This birthday, she proves that reinvention is always possible, and she's doing it on her own terms.

Aamir Khan reveals his 90-year-old mother Zeenat Khan will make her debut in 'Sitaare Zameen Par': ‘Meri himmat nahi hogi Ammi ko poochne ki'
Aamir Khan has thrilled fans with the recent revelation that his much-awaited film 'Sitaare Zameen Par' will also feature his sister Nikhat Khan and mother Zeenat Khan . While Nikhat is known for her roles in several films, this marks the acting debut of his mother, Zeenat Khan. Aamir opens up about mother Zeenat Khan's debut Speaking at a media interaction held in Mumbai, Aamir opened up about how his mother came to be a part of the RS Prasanna-directed film. He revealed that his mother had never accompanied him to any film shoot before. One day, as he was about to leave for the shoot, she asked him where he was heading and what the film was about. Sitaare Zameen Par | Title Track 'But on the morning of the song shoot, Ammi called and asked, 'Aap kahaan shooting kar rahe hain? Humko bhi aana hai shooting pe aaj.' So, I said, 'Chaliye, aaiye.' I sent her the car, and my sister brought her to the shoot. She came in a wheelchair. It was a joyful wedding song, and we were having fun shooting it while she watched us,' he shared. Zeenat Khan's reaction when Aamir requested to give a shot As Zeenat Khan sat observing the vibrant wedding sequence being filmed, director RS Prasanna had an idea. He asked Aamir whether his mother would consider appearing in the scene as one of the wedding guests. He suggested it would be lovely to have her be part of the song. Aamir admitted that he didn't feel confident asking his mother to act. 'I told him, 'Tu pagal ho gaya hai? Meri himmat nahi hogi Ammi ko poochne ki, ki film mein kaam karo, shot do. She is very ziddi. She is not going to listen. Don't waste your time.' He kept urging me to at least ask her,' he added. The 'PK' actor finally told his mother that Prasanna wanted her in a shot — and to his surprise, she agreed. 'I was shocked! So, she's there in one or two shots. It's the only film of mine that she has ever been a part of.' Visibly emotional, the actor said the experience was priceless for him, especially as his mother will turn 91 just a week before the film's release. Speaking about his sister, Aamir said that Nikhat plays a character in the film and has a couple of scenes. This marks their first on-screen collaboration, and Aamir hinted they may work together again in the future. About Sitaare Zameen Par Sitaare Zameen Par, starring Genelia Deshmukh alongside Aamir Khan, is slated for release in cinemas on June 20. Nagarjuna Akkineni drops official pictures from Akhil Akkineni's wedding to Zainab Ravdjee: 'We witnessed a dream come true'
Nagarjuna Akkineni 's son, actor Akhil Akkineni , tied the knot with artist and entrepreneur Zainab Ravdjee in an intimate traditional wedding ceremony at the Akkineni residence today (June 6). Nagarjuna has now shared official glimpses of the wedding along with a heartwarming note on his social media handles. check out the post here: Akhil Akkineni and Zainab Ravdjee's wedding The wedding, held at 3:35 a.m., followed traditional Telugu customs and featured the bride and groom in elegant ivory ensembles. Nagarjuna treated fans to some unseen pictures from the ceremony, including one of Akhil tying the mangalsutram. Akhil's brother, actor Naga Chaitanya, was also seen in the pictures along with his wife, Sobhita Dhulipala. Nagarjuna's wife, former actress Amala Akkineni, looked ethereal in the photos. Deets of the dinner date Akhil Akkineni was on 'With immense joy, Amala and I are delighted to share that our dear son has married his beloved Zainab in a beautiful ceremony (3:35 a.m.) at our home, where our hearts belong. We witnessed a dream come true, surrounded by love, laughter, and those dearest to us. We seek your blessings as they begin this new journey together. With love and gratitude,' the Mass actor wrote while sharing the pictures. The couple had announced their engagement last year after dating for a while. Akhil had shared some dreamy pictures from the engagement ceremony along with a note: 'Found my forever. Happy to announce that Zainab Ravdjee and I are happily engaged.' Zainab, the daughter of Hyderabad-based industrialist Zulfi Ravdjee, comes from a family rooted in the construction industry. The wedding was graced by several Tollywood celebrities, including Chiranjeevi, Ram Charan, and director Prashanth Neel.
